About monica_hamburg

Monica Hamburg is a writer and social media evangelist in Vancouver, Canada. Her investigations and observations on social media (especially Crowdsourcing), and its relation to business and connecting, form the basis of her blog, "Me Like the Interweb". She is a frequent contributor to the popular digital marketing magazine "One Degree", as well as a former actor and class clown who now uses her dry humour for speaking engagements and in her blog "Your Dose of Lunacy".
